The small stand for the telephoto lens was mainly used to support the telephoto lens. Due to the large weight of the telephoto lens, if there was no support, it was easy to cause the lens to be damaged or fall. Moreover, only the telephoto lens mounting plate could only be fixed at the lens mount. Long-term use would damage the lens mount and reduce its service life. A telephoto lens was a type of photographic lens that had a longer focal length than a standard lens. It could capture scenes and details from a distance and create unique visual effects. Telephoto lenses were divided into two types: ordinary telephoto lenses and super telephoto lenses. The focal length of an ordinary telephoto lens was close to that of a standard lens, while the focal length of an ultra-telephoto lens was far greater than that of a standard lens. The telephoto lens was suitable for shooting scenery, sports, close-ups, and other topics. It had a unique charm. Some mobile phones were also equipped with telephoto lenses that could zoom in and simplify the background, making it suitable for shooting distant objects and buildings. The use of a telephoto lens required attention to the problem of shaking, which could be solved by using a tripod or a stable support. When choosing a telephoto lens, factors such as focal length, anti-shake function, and optical performance needed to be considered.

In a telephoto camera, the "small base" usually referred to a size sensor. For example, the Nikon Coolpix P1000 was equipped with a 1/2.3-inch sensor, which was relatively small. The image quality of the small base sensor had its own characteristics when shooting at a long focal length. In most cases, the image quality was in line with the performance of the sensor of this size. The color was good overall, but there might be a lot of noise. In the longer focal length, the image quality would be significantly affected due to factors such as the aperture becoming smaller and the air disturbance. <a href="/?from=ask_words" style="color:red" target="_blank">Read more exciting novels for free</a>
The focal length of a laser focusing lens could not be determined simply. Many factors needed to be considered. From the scanning range and spot diameter, as the focal length increases, the scanning range and spot diameter will increase correspondingly, but the power density will decrease rapidly, which may be unfavorable for processing. Moreover, in the F-Theta field mirror, as the focal length increased, the difference between the actual theta and tg theta would cause the distortion to increase. In terms of laser cutting, different materials and cutting requirements have different requirements for the focal point position (related to focal length). For example, for a small laser cutting machine, the distance between the focusing lens and the material (basically 50.8MM and 63.5MM, etc.), when cutting carbon steel and stainless steel, according to the thickness of the plate, the focus position (related to the focal length) needs to be adjusted to achieve better cutting quality. When the focus of the fiber laser cutting machine is in the best position, the slit is the smallest and the efficiency is the highest to obtain the best cutting result. In the laser marking machine, the focal length of the focusing lens would also affect the effect after focusing. Under ideal circumstances, the position of the focusing point depended on the focal length and the angle of the lens, and the scanning range of the focusing lens was affected by the focal length. Over-increasing the scanning range may cause problems such as the spot becoming thicker and distorting. Therefore, it is necessary to judge whether the focal length of the laser focusing lens is large or small according to the specific application scenarios (such as cutting, marking, etc.), the processing materials, the requirements for power density and the effect of the spot. <a href="/?from=ask_words" style="color:red" target="_blank">Read more exciting novels for free</a>

DSLR cameras had a lens blurring function. It could be achieved in many ways, such as adjusting the aperture size. The larger the aperture (F4 and below are considered large apertures in the DSLR, such as F5, F8, etc.), the more blurred the background. Controlling the shooting distance, holding the lens closer to the subject, after focusing, the background would appear blurred. The closer the distance, the more blurred the background. Adjusting the focal length, the longer the focal length (55mm and above is a telephoto), the more blurred the background.
